

A compact wetland reserve of ponds, reedbeds and scrub offering intimate nature and wildlife scenes — ideal for birding, dragonflies, reflections and textured marsh landscapes. Best at dawn or dusk for low-angle light and active birds; spring–summer for dragonflies and breeding birds, autumn for migrating species. Easy paths and a short boardwalk give close access; surfaces can be muddy so wear boots. No entry fee; limited parking nearby and reachable from Harrogate by bus or bike.
